Choosing the Right Destination:
When selecting a mountain getaway destination, consider both accessibility and affordability. Look for places that offer stunning natural landscapes while also providing various options for accommodations within your budget range.
1. The Appalachian Mountains:
The Appalachian Mountains span across Eastern North America and are known for their scenic beauty. From the Great Smoky Mountains National Park in Tennessee to Shenandoah National Park in Virginia, there are numerous opportunities for hiking, wildlife spotting, camping, fishing, or simply admiring panoramic views.
2. The Rocky Mountains:
The Rocky Mountains stretch through several western states including Colorado (home to famous ski resorts like Aspen), Wyoming (with its iconic Yellowstone National Park), Montana (featuring Glacier National Park), Utah (offering world-class skiing at Salt Lake City), and more. These mountains provide endless possibilities for outdoor adventures such as skiing or snowboarding during winter months while offering hiking trails with breathtaking vistas throughout the year.
3. The Swiss Alps:
For those seeking an international adventure without breaking the bank entirely; consider visiting Switzerland’s lesser-known Alpine destinations like Engelberg or Arosa instead of popular tourist hotspots like Zermatt or St Moritz. You’ll still be able to experience Switzerland’s picturesque landscapes along with charming alpine villages while saving money on accommodation costs.
Accommodation Options:
Once you’ve decided on your destination(s), it’s time to find affordable accommodation options that don’t compromise on comfort. Consider the following suggestions:
1. Camping:
Camping is an excellent choice for budget-conscious travelers who want to be close to nature. Many mountain destinations offer campsites with stunning surroundings and basic facilities like bathrooms, showers, and picnic areas. Pack your tent or rent one locally to save on luggage space.
2. Hostels:
If you prefer a roof over your head but still want to keep costs low, hostels are a fantastic option. They provide affordable dormitory-style accommodation while offering communal spaces where you can meet fellow travelers and share experiences.
3. Vacation Rentals:
Renting a cabin or vacation home can be cost-effective, especially if you’re traveling with family or friends and plan to stay for an extended period. Websites like Airbnb or VRBO often have listings in mountainous areas at various price points.
Activities on a Budget:
While exploring mountains offers breathtaking views at no cost, there are other activities that won’t break the bank either.
1. Hiking:
Hiking trails are abundant in mountainous regions, providing opportunities for adventure enthusiasts of all experience levels. Research local trails beforehand and choose routes based on difficulty level and duration that suit your fitness level.
2. Wildlife Spotting:
Many mountain areas are home to diverse wildlife such as bears, elk, deer, birds of prey, and more. Keep an eye out during hikes or visit designated wildlife viewing spots within national parks for a chance to observe these magnificent creatures in their natural habitat.

Budget-Friendly Dining Options:
When it comes to dining while on your mountain getaway, there are ways to enjoy delicious food without spending a fortune.
1. Local Eateries:
Explore small towns and villages near your destination, as they often have local eateries offering regional delicacies at reasonable prices. These establishments not only provide an authentic culinary experience but also support the local economy.
2. Self-Catering:
If you’re staying in a vacation rental or camping, take advantage of kitchen facilities to prepare meals yourself. Visit nearby grocery stores or farmers’ markets for fresh ingredients and get creative with cooking while enjoying beautiful mountain views from your accommodation.
Transportation Tips:
Consider these budget-friendly transportation options when planning your mountain getaway:
1. Carpooling:
If traveling with friends or family, carpooling can significantly reduce transportation costs by splitting fuel expenses among all passengers.
2. Public Transportation:
Research public transportation options available in your chosen destination(s). Many mountainous areas offer bus services that connect major attractions, hiking trails, and towns within the region.
3. Biking/Walking:
For short distances within towns or between attractions, consider biking or walking instead of relying on taxis or other modes of transport. It’s not only budget-friendly but also an opportunity to explore at a leisurely pace.
